Trends in Research & Evaluation Funding Landscape
The field of Research & Evaluation has been evolving rapidly, influenced by significant policy and market shifts. Funding opportunities are becoming increasingly competitive, and there’s a clear emphasis on evidence-based approaches in granting processes. Both government agencies and private foundations prioritize research initiatives that promise measurable impact and advancement in various domains, particularly in education, health, and technology.
In the context of grants like the Financial Assistance to High School Senior Athlete, foundations are not solely interested in the outcomes of individual projects but are also focused on how proposals align with broader societal goals. This shift means that applicants must clearly demonstrate how their research and evaluation efforts address pressing issues. Evidence that connects proposed work to real-world challenges will create stronger proposals.
Policy and Market Shifts Affecting Research & Evaluation Projects
One notable regulation that significantly impacts grant applications in Research & Evaluation is the implementation of the National Science Foundation (NSF) guidelines, which mandate rigorous standards for research proposals. The NSF’s criteria require that all projects demonstrate potential for both scientific advancement and relevance to societal needs. This regulation has redefined the expectations for what constitutes a viable research project.
Additionally, there is a growing trend towards interdisciplinary approaches within research. Applicants are encouraged to devise studies that transcend traditional boundaries, incorporating methods and insights from various fields such as behavioral sciences, technology development, and social sciences. This reflects a broader understanding of complex societal challenges and emphasizes the need for innovative solutions that can be derived from integrated research strategies.
With the advent of large-scale databases and big data analytics, there’s also a significant pivot towards the use of quantitative data in shaping policy and funding decisions. Funders are increasingly interested in projects that utilize robust data analysis to inform findings and recommendations. This entails that researchers must develop strong methodological frameworks underpinning their evaluation processes, which can sometimes necessitate advanced training or partnerships with data science experts.
Prioritized Research Areas and Capacity Requirements
Within the realm of Research & Evaluation, areas such as mental health, educational outcomes, and public health are currently prioritized. The funding landscape reflects a responsive shift to pressing social issues, especially in light of recent global crises that highlight the need for adaptive and effective research methodologies. The movement towards emphasizing mental health, for example, has led to calls for more comprehensive evaluations of existing support systems and their efficacy.
Capacity requirements are evolving as a result. Organizations must not only be capable of conducting thorough evaluations but also adept in communicating findings effectively to a broader audience. Funders favor applicants who can demonstrate previous successful evaluations and a clear strategy for stakeholder engagement. Those without experience in these areas may find themselves at a disadvantage.
Additionally, the competition for Research & Evaluation grants necessitates that applicants allocate substantial resources toward building partnerships. Collaborative efforts across organizations can enhance the depth and breadth of a proposal, showcasing a united front in addressing research questions and demonstrating shared goals.
Unique Delivery Challenges in Research & Evaluation
Despite the opportunities present in the Research & Evaluation landscape, applicants should be aware of inherent delivery challenges that can impede project advancement. One notable constraint unique to this sector is the varying interpretation and implementation of research ethics standards. Rigorous ethical compliance is critical, but different entities may have disparate interpretations of what constitutes ethical research practices.
These variances can complicate collaborative projects, especially when stakeholders have different policies regarding confidentiality and informed consent. Consequently, researchers must invest time in aligning their ethical frameworks, which can sometimes delay project initiation. Ensuring that all participating entities adhere to a unified set of ethical guidelines is essential to mitigate these delays and ensure the integrity of the research process.
Another significant challenge is the need for sustained funding throughout the lifecycle of a research project. Research and evaluation often require ongoing capital to address emerging questions or adapt methodologies in response to initial findings. Without sufficient financial backing, the risk of project stagnation increases, particularly when faced with unforeseen obstacles that necessitate adjustments in approach.
In addition, limited access to historical data can pose significant challenges to evaluative research. Many projects rely on pre-existing datasets to inform their evaluations; however, gaps in data availability or documentation can hinder researchers’ ability to draw meaningful conclusions. Thus, establishing strong data management practices and fostering relationships with data custodians is vital to alleviate this constraint.
Regulatory Compliance and Funding Barriers
Eligibility barriers for Research & Evaluation grants often stem from stringent compliance requirements. As noted earlier, adherence to NSF guidelines is one such regulatory framework that can pose challenges for applicants. Proposals must not only meet initial criteria but also be adaptable to ongoing changes in regulatory expectations. This can limit the pool of eligible applicants and may inadvertently exclude high-quality projects that do not meet every regulatory stipulation.
Moreover, research proposals that do not clearly address the relevance of their findings to broader societal needs may struggle to secure funding. Many grant committees now assess potential projects through the lens of societal impact, which can disqualify initiatives that are deemed too narrow or abstract. Demonstrating a clear link between research objectives and applicable outcomes is essential for successful funding applications.
To complicate matters further, some funding agencies have specific disqualifications based on the types of activities they will not support. For example, grants aimed at Research & Evaluation may not fund projects that focus solely on basic research without a clear path to application or those lacking a defined evaluation component. Understanding these nuances is critical for applicants to navigate the funding landscape successfully.
Measurement and Reporting Expectations
Once funding is secured, understanding measurement expectations becomes vital. Grantees in the Research & Evaluation sector must delineate clear, quantifiable outcomes. These may involve not only direct outputs such as publications and reports but also the effectiveness of research in addressing identified issues. Key Performance Indicators (KPIs) are pivotal to demonstrate success and compliance with funding requirements.
Common KPIs for Research & Evaluation projects can include metrics related to participant engagement, data collection success rates, and the application of findings in policymaking processes. Funders are also increasingly looking for evidence of how research outcomes influence real-world applications, such as changes in legislation or improvements in service delivery based on research findings.
Additionally, reporting requirements have become more stringent. Funded projects must provide regular updates, detailing progress towards established goals and outcomes. This necessitates a well-defined framework for tracking project activities, outcomes, and lessons learned. Grantees need to prepare for comprehensive assessments and audit processes that ensure compliance with both funder expectations and regulatory standards.
